We have 25 bedrooms incorporating single, double, twin, triple and family rooms accommodating up to 5 persons. A Baby\'s cot and child\'s fold down bed can also be supplied. All rooms are ensuite with power shower. Each room has Cable/Satellite TV, with 22 stations including CNN and Sky Sports. All rooms include:
* Flat screen TV with integrated DVD player (DVDs including those suitable for very young children are provided free of charge).
* WIFI hot spot- Free High-Speed Wireless Broadband Access.
* Fridge, Microwave, Iron/Ironing Board, Hairdryer.
* Tea/Coffee and Biscuits.
* Direct Dial Telephone with own individual telephone numbers so that your friends can call you directly in your room.
* All local land line calls are free of charge.
* Laptop available for Internet access.
* Facsimile, copying, printing and word processing available on request.
* Study desks and lamps provided for students.
*Secure Luggage Storage, Late Checkouts and Laundry Service available on request.

We also have a hydrotherapy unit and infrared sauna in our health and relaxation chalet use of which is included in your stay.

Other facilities include 2 Large flood-lit private secure car parks, Secluded Picturesque Gardens, Lounge / Reading Room and a Conservatory style Dining Room in which a very substantial Four Course Irish Breakfast is served from 6.30a.m. to 9.00a.m. on weekdays and from 8.00a.m. to 10.00a.m. at weekends.

Flexible times available on request. Breakfast costs vary depending on menu selected. Vegetarian, coeliac, diabetic, low fat and low carbohydrate diets catered for. Any other dietary requirements given full consideration. Please advise of any special dietary needs, at time of booking. Tipperary Spring Water (Still and Sparkling) available free of charge.

DIRECTIONS FROM DUBLIN AIRPORT TO BROOKVILLE HOUSE
BY CAR:
When you come out of the Airport Complex, go Southbound on the M1, towards Dublin City, for about two km, where you will come to The M50. Get onto this and go Southbound again. Take Exit 14 marked the N31, then go straight through the next two roundabouts, first one marked the N31 and the second, marked the N11. You will come to a dual carriageway, which is the N11. Go straight through the N11 and into Newtownpark Ave., keep straight until you see a Texaco garage on your left, turn right at the set of traffic lights just past it and we are the last entrance on the right hand side before the next FULL set of traffic lights (four roads). There are two B&B signs, with a cream wall and lots of trees and ivy.
If for some reason you take a wrong turn and get lost and need to ask directions, we are situated on the Deansgrange Road at the new signalised junction with the Monkstown Ring Road and our mobile number is 00353872376481.

TO BROOKVILLE BY BUS FROM CITY CENTRE
The easiest way to reach us from the city centre is to take the 4 bus from O Connell Bridge (bridge over the Liffey on the main street of Dublin), take bus number 4, which will travel out in a bus-corridor, and drop you opposite the Entrance to Brookville House in 20-25 mins. This bus goes every 15 minutes on weekdays. If you get off at the Stradbrook, (when the first time bus turns left off the Deansgrange Road also called the Deansgrange Link Road Stop) and look behind you, across the road through the traffic lights, you will see our B&B signs. Brookville is a large cream building with lots of trees and ivy, the first entrance on the left. It also goes on weekends, however on Saturdays and Sundays the 46A provides a more frequent service into the city centre at 10 minute intervals (in Dublin you catch it on D'Olier St), this is a 5 minute walk away (at the Deansgrange Crossroads, you will see the Grange Pub) straight down the Deansgrange Road. The 45 bus also goes from outside our gate and this goes as far as Merrion Square in Dublin City Centre. On Fridays and Saturdays nitelink buses such as 84N run from midnight to 4am in the morning from D'Olier Street just beside O Connell Bridge on the Trinity side, these drop you a 5 minute walk from us. A taxi fare from Dublin City Centre to Brookville House should cost 14 - 20 euro for a car for 4 people, the number to ring is 01-4542525.

TO BROOKVILLE - BY TRAIN (D.A.R.T.)
From Connolly Station, take the DART (electric train) to Blackrock and then take the 4 bus as detailed above or you can take the D.A.R.T. (electric train) to Dun Laoghaire and outside the Station, take the bus number 63, for 8 minutes and get off at the shop called "Primetime Quick Pick', the Abbey Road stop. The bus will turn left, but you walk straight through the roundabout and down the hill called Stradbrook Hill, for four minutes and you will see Brookville House across the road from the new signalised junction. There are two B&B Signs; cream walls around the house, with lots of trees and ivy, it is the first entrance on the left after you go straight through the traffic lights. We often will collect you from Blackrock Station if you ring us when leaving Connolly Station.
